0:24 place to get that from so uh if you
0:26 missed the last one the use case for
0:29 doing this is to well number one have
0:32 your files that are a source for your
0:35 reports be in a place that is not
0:38 only on your local machine so in the
0:40 cloud backed up accessible to other
0:42 people and also you don't need to use
0:46 the gateway to refresh on that source so
0:49 we're going to move in this case we have
0:51 for our source here
0:55 have a Json file and the Json file is on
0:57 my local computer and I'm going to
0:58 upload this to SharePoint and then
1:00 change the file path and this sounds
1:02 like it would be really straightforward
1:04 however SharePoint online does some
1:06 really weird things to file paths that
1:09 makes it a little bit less intuitive
1:10 than you would expect
1:13 so what I'm going to do is open up
1:15 SharePoint here and I've just got a
1:17 plain SharePoint site an e SharePoint
1:19 online site will work SharePoint on
1:20 premise will work too but you need to
1:22 use the Gateway if it's on premise
1:25 so I've got my Json file here I'm just
1:26 going to drag and drop it into a
1:29 SharePoint library and there it is and
1:31 I'm going to go to the full document
1:32 Library which is this one here because
1:34 you get more menu options in here and
1:36 then I'm going to click on the file so
1:37 I'm not going to click on the file name
1:39 because that'll open the file I'm just
1:40 going to highlight this file
1:44 and then click on this little eye icon
1:47 in the corner here so this is going to
1:51 give me my file properties and from here
1:53 scroll all the way down there is a thing
1:57 that says path and that is what you want
1:58 because if you open up this file in
2:01 SharePoint it'll give you and if it's a
2:03 Json file to give you a file preview URL
2:06 and this URL won't work
2:07 if it's
2:09 um if it's an Excel file it will give
2:13 you and the Excel online Link which will
2:15 not work so we need the actual file path
